Consider the following statements about Gross Domestic
Product (GDP): 1. GDP measures the total value of all final goods and services produced within a country's borders in a specific period. 2. GDP includes the value of intermediate goods to avoid double counting. 3. GDP is a reliable indicator of the standard of living in a country. Which of the above statements are correct?Solution
GDP measures the total value of final goods and services produced within a country's borders (statement 1). It excludes intermediate goods to avoid double counting (statement 2 is incorrect). While GDP reflects economic activity, it does not fully capture the standard of living (statement 3).
